package org.apache.hudi.common.util.queue;

import org.apache.hudi.common.util.ClosableIterator;
import org.apache.log4j.LogManager;
import org.apache.log4j.Logger;

import java.util.Iterator;

/**
 * Iterator based producer which pulls entry from iterator and produces items for the queue.
 *
 * @param  Item type produced for the buffer.
 */
public class IteratorBasedQueueProducer implements HoodieProducer {

  private static final Logger LOG = LogManager.getLogger(IteratorBasedQueueProducer.class);

  private final Iterator inputIterator;

  public IteratorBasedQueueProducer(Iterator inputIterator) {
    this.inputIterator = inputIterator;
  }

  @Override
  public void produce(HoodieMessageQueue queue) throws Exception {
    LOG.info("starting to buffer records");
    while (inputIterator.hasNext()) {
      queue.insertRecord(inputIterator.next());
    }
    LOG.info("finished buffering records");
  }

  @Override
  public void close() {
    if (inputIterator instanceof ClosableIterator) {
      ((ClosableIterator) inputIterator).close();
    }
  }
}
